What “Medically Approved” Means in Beauty and Lip Care

In everyday skincare, “medically approved” often refers to products that are dermatologist tested, supported by clinical evidence and aligned with regulatory guidance for safety and labelling. It is not a replacement for medical advice, but it signals that a formula has been deliberately evaluated.

Core ingredients to know:

  • Ceramides support the skin barrier and reduce moisture loss.
  • Niacinamide helps with tone irregularities and visible pores while being well tolerated.
  • Salicylic acid (SA) lifts away dead cells to smooth texture.
  • Hyaluronic acid (HA) hydrates by binding water within the skin’s surface layers.
  • SPF protects from UV damage, a daily must across all tones and skin types.

Match routines to goals:

  • Texture smoothing: salicylic acid, gentle chemical exfoliation
  • Barrier repair: ceramides, cholesterol, fatty acids
  • Brightening: niacinamide, vitamin C, tranexamic acid
  • Hydration: hyaluronic acid, glycerin, colloidal oatmeal

Explore Medically Approved Beauty Care Products: How to Choose

Cleansers

Choose gentle, pH-balanced, fragrance free formulas. Gel or lotion textures suit normal to oily skin. Creamy balms suit dry or reactive skin.

Moisturisers

Look for barrier-restoring creams and lotions with ceramides, niacinamide, and humectants. If you live in a dry climate or work in air-conditioning, switch to richer textures at night.

Serums

  • Vitamin C in the morning for radiance
  • Niacinamide or TXA if uneven tone is a concern
  • Retinoids at night when appropriate, with moisturiser buffer
  • HA for daily hydration

Sunscreen

Broad-spectrum SPF 30 should be your baseline. SPF 30 blocks about 97% of UVB and reapplication is key to real-world protection (Source: NCBI). Sustained daily use has even been linked with a lower risk of invasive melanoma. (Source: LippincottPubMed)

Building a Simple and Effective Skincare Routine

Follow this easy sequence and adjust texture by season:

  1. Cleanse with a gentle, pH-balanced formula
  2. Treat with serum if needed (vitamin C or niacinamide by day, retinoids by night)
  3. Moisturise with a barrier-supporting cream
  4. SPF every morning, reapply every 2 hours outdoors

Frequency and Layering Tips:

  • Start 3 times a week for actives, then increase as tolerated
  • Patch test new items for 24 to 48 hours
  • Keep a simple core routine while you test add-ons
